Class HvlOAuthUserClaimQueryModel
java.lang.Object
tr.com.havelsan.javarch.dto.model.query.HvlQueryModel
tr.com.havelsan.javarch.oauth.jpa.data.common.module.user.model.query.HvlOAuthUserQueryModel
tr.com.havelsan.javarch.oauth.jpa.data.common.module.user.model.query.HvlOAuthUserClaimQueryModel
- All Implemented Interfaces:
Serializable
,Hv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
public class HvlOAuthUserClaimQueryModel
extends HvlOAuthUserQueryModel
implements Hv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
A data transfer object which is used to filter query.
- See Also:
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ionGets addable id set.Gets assigned entity id.Gets assigned entity type.Gets only assigned.Gets removeable id set.void
setAddableIdSet
(Set<Long> addableIdSet) Sets addable id set.void
setAssignedEntityId
(Long assignedEntityId) Sets assigned entity id.void
setAssignedEntityType
(HvlOAuthUserAssignableEntityType assignedEntityType) Sets assigned entity type.void
setOnlyAssigned
(Boolean onlyAssigned) Sets only assigned.void
setRemoveableIdSet
(Set<Long> removeableIdSet) Sets removeable id set.Methods inherited from class tr.com.havelsan.javarch.oauth.jpa.data.common.module.user.model.query.HvlOAuthUserQueryModel
getAdmin, getDn, getEmail, getEndDate, getExpired, getId, getIntegrationCode, getLocked, getName, getOnlyNoDn, getOnlyWithDn, getPassword, getPasswordExpired, getStartDate, getSurname, getSystem, getTenantIdentifier, getTrustedProxyIdSet, getUserDetailId, getUserDetailUuid, getUsername, getUserRegistrationSourceType, getUserTypeId, getUuid, isDeleted, setAdmin, setDeleted, setDn, setEmail, setEndDate, setExpired, setId, setIntegrationCode, setLocked, setName, setOnlyNoDn, setOnlyWithDn, setPassword, setPasswordExpired, setStartDate, setSurname, setSystem, setTenantIdentifier, setTrustedProxyIdSet, setUserDetailId, setUserDetailUuid, setUsername, setUserRegistrationSourceType, setUserTypeId, setUuid
Methods inherited from class tr.com.havelsan.javarch.dto.model.query.HvlQueryModel
getFilters, getPageable, setFilters, setPageable
-
Constructor Details
-
HvlOAuthUserClaimQueryModel
public HvlOAuthUserClaimQueryModel()
-
-
Method Details
-
getAssignedEntityType
Gets assigned entity type.- Specified by:
getAssignedEntityType
in interfaceHv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
- Returns:
- the assigned entity type
-
setAssignedEntityType
Sets assigned entity type.- Parameters:
assignedEntityType
- the assigned entity type
-
getAssignedEntityId
Gets assigned entity id.- Specified by:
getAssignedEntityId
in interfaceHv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
- Returns:
- the assigned entity id
-
setAssignedEntityId
Sets assigned entity id.- Parameters:
assignedEntityId
- the assigned entity id
-
getOnlyAssigned
Gets only assigned.- Specified by:
getOnlyAssigned
in interfaceHv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
- Returns:
- the only assigned
-
setOnlyAssigned
Sets only assigned.- Parameters:
onlyAssigned
- the only assigned
-
getAddableIdSet
Gets addable id set.- Specified by:
getAddableIdSet
in interfaceHv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
- Returns:
- the addable id set
-
setAddableIdSet
Sets addable id set.- Parameters:
addableIdSet
- the addable id set
-
getRemoveableIdSet
Gets removeable id set.- Specified by:
getRemoveableIdSet
in interfaceHvlOAuthEntityClaimQueryModelStructure<HvlOAuthUserAssignableEntityType>
- Returns:
- the removeable id set
-
setRemoveableIdSet
Sets removeable id set.- Parameters:
removeableIdSet
- the removeable id set
-